A Seasonal Movie Talk Card from Charlie and the Chocolate Factory
Many of the chocolate ‘sculptures’ featured in Charlie and the Chocolate Factory were made by a tiny bespoke chocolaterie in Brighton called Choccywoccydoodah who went on to display the edible props in the shop after filming finished. Discuss this film … Continue reading
